Transaction 654784e1fdfd96a059b608687d41a10ec78e60af91c783d651d5306fac108e61
1 Input
1 Output
-
654784e1fdfd96a059b608687d41a10ec78e60af91c783d651d5306fac108e61:0
- value
- 159288335
- script pubkey
- OP_0 OP_PUSHBYTES_20 125342586af956e896c7d2ef2bb2c2679b7dda33
- address
- bc1qzff5ykr2l9tw39k86thjhvkzv7dhmk3nky46yd